CoralTree Hospitality to manage Poco Diablo Resort

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 8 January 2025
🏝 CoralTree Hospitality now manages Poco Diablo Resort in Sedona, Arizona. The 137-room resort, to be rebranded as Outbound Sedona, will experience renovations including an enhanced spa, renovated rooms, and reimagined public spaces. It offers amenities like Willows Kitchen & Wine Bar, a heated pool, and 8,500 sq ft of meeting space. Nearby, guests have access to Sedona Golf Resort's par-71 course. CoralTree, founded in 2018, has over 35 properties and is a subsidiary of Lowe.

Albert Hotel opens its doors in Fredericksburg, Texas

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 7 January 2025
🏡 New Waterloo opened Albert Hotel in Fredericksburg, Texas on January 3. The company will launch Fidelity Hotel in Cleveland on January 27. The Albert Hotel, with 105 guest rooms, includes the historic Albertina House and offers dining, a spa, and event spaces totaling 3,600 sq ft. Michelin-starred Chef Michael Fojtasek leads The Restaurant at Albert Hotel. The Spa will open later in the week, featuring seven treatment rooms. Event capacities are up to 220 guests indoors and 90 outdoors.

Chef Johnny Lee opens Rasarumah, a Southeast Asian restaurant in Los Angeles

  • Kevin Gray
  • 6 January 2025
🍗 Chef Johnny Lee launched Rasarumah in collaboration with Last Word Hospitality on November 24. Lee previously operated Side Chick and Pearl River Deli, which closed in February, in Los Angeles. Located in Historic Filipinotown, the restaurant occupies a former brassiere factory's ground floor. Rasarumah offers a 40-seat space with a menu featuring Malaysian and Southeast Asian cuisine, including dishes like rojak salad, satay skewers, and banana leaf steamed black cod. The design echoes Penang's cafes, and the wine list includes global selections.

Hyatt debuts Hyatt Centric brand in Nepal

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 6 January 2025
🏠 Hyatt Hotels Corp. has introduced Hyatt Centric in Nepal, transforming Hyatt Place Kathmandu into Hyatt Centric Soalteemode Kathmandu. The hotel offers 153 guestrooms, over 8,600 square feet of event space, and two new dining venues: NOON and ZING Sky Pool Bar & Deck. The property features a redesigned lobby and amenities for modern travelers, aiming to weave Kathmandu's essence into every aspect of the guest experience.

Shangri-La debuts in Cambodia with Phnom Penh hotel

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 3 January 2025
🏙 Shangri-La Group launches in Cambodia with a waterfront hotel in Phnom Penh's Koh Pich district, opened December 28, 2024. The 303-room Shangri-La Phnom Penh is part of a 228-meter tri-tower, one of the tallest in the city, offering views of the Mekong, Tonle Sap, and Tonle Bassac rivers. Interiors feature a mix of Art Deco, neo-classical, and Khmer styles. Facilities to include a large ballroom, infinity pool, and spa. Cambodia's hotel market is expected to reach $93.85 million by 2025. Shangri-La operates over 100 hotels worldwide.

Minor Hotels strengthens Italy presence with NH Collection hotel in the Alps

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 2 January 2025
🏖️ Minor Hotels is set to open NH Collection Alagna Mirtillo Rosso in Italy's Pennine Alps in March, catering to ski enthusiasts with its proximity to 150 kilometers of slopes in Monte Rosa Ski Hotel. The renovated hotel will feature 56 rooms, a wellness center with separate 300 m² adults-only and 400 m² family areas, offering pools, saunas, and treatment rooms. The NH Collection marks its 10th anniversary in Italy, increasing its Italian portfolio to 17 hotels, while Minor Hotels Europe & Americas has 60 Italian properties.

Prima Asset Management partners with Schwartz Family Co. to boost London hotel investments

  • Kathakali Nandi
  • 31 December 2024
🏦 Singapore's Prima Asset Management partnered with Australia's Schwartz Family Co. to boost London real estate presence. Prima's hotel project in Paddington will see the Victorian-era hotel expand from 68 to over 80 rooms after renovations. Acquired in June 2024, financed by OakNorth Bank, the project is in collaboration with Capilon Group. Schwartz Family Co., with a portfolio of 15 hotels and over 4,300 rooms, invests in Prima's vision for sustainable hospitality. London, a top hotel investment destination, saw €2.6 billion in hotel deals in H1 2024, up 215% from H1 2023. Prima aims for another hotel acquisition by Q1 2025.
